Contaminant-specific targeting of olfactory sensory neuron classes: connecting neuron class impairment with behavioural deficits.
The olfactory system of fish comprises several classes of olfactory sensory neurons (OSNs). The odourants L-alanine and taurocholic acid (TCA) specifically activate microvillous or ciliated OSNs, respectively, in fish. متن کاملOlfactory marker protein gene: its structure and olfactory neuron-specific expression in transgenic mice.
Olfactory marker protein (OMP) genomic clones were isolated from a Charon 4A phage lambda rat genomic library. A 16.5-kilobase (kb) fragment of the rat genome containing the gene was isolated and characterized.
